My garden

  This a picture of the garden at first planting in March.  It is 40' x 12' box 12" deep. I tilled the dirt on the ground  6-8" deep and tilled in mulch prior to adding the soil mix. The soil is 1/3 mulch, 1/3 native soil and 1/3 manure (supposedly).
